What is the ecostore battery energy storage system?

The EcoStore is a pole -mounted 30kVA/65kWh three phase Battery Energy Storage System (BESS) ideally suited to a community energy storage application. It consists of three pole mounted cabinets as shown in Figure 1, each containing a 10kVA/21.9kWh BESS coordinated together to operate as a three phase BESS.

How do I connect a cat 5 battery module?

•Connect battery modules sharing a shelf with a black jumper cable (L) going from the rear battery COM OUT port to the front battery COM IN port. •Do not install a CAT 5 cable to the last battery module’s COM OUT port (M). •Remaining COM cables can be left disconnected.

How should a battery be installed?

For hotter climates, install the battery out of direct sun- light. Exposure to temperatures above the optimal tem- perature range will impact battery performance. For colder climates, install the battery in a conditioned space. Exposure to temperatures below the optimal ambient temperature range will impact battery perfor- mance. Compliance
